Meeting notes, Tumblebin ops review: the laundry-locker access flow now uses one-time codes instead of shared PINs. Codes expire after 20 minutes; expired-code complaints are the most common support ticket. Agents can reissue a code once per order without approval. Anything beyond a single reissue, or suspected locker tampering, should be escalated to the person below.

account owner for bawip-tahag: Raleth Quenok

## Onboarding: Larkspur Firmware Update Channel

Welcome to the Larkspur embedded team. The firmware update channel pushes signed images to field devices in staged cohorts; never promote a build past the canary cohort without two approvals. Future maintainers should note that the signing service holds the channel keys in an offline vault, restored only during incidents. If the vault must be reopened, the custodian will ask you to recite the passphrase recorded below.

unlock words, hahip-baduf: holwyn-istath-julvan

**Ticket: Connection failures after monthly partition rollover**

Plugin authors integrating with the Fernbrook Analytics API have reported intermittent connection failures on the first of each month. Root cause: our `events` table is partitioned by month, and the partition-creation job runs after midnight, so early queries hit a missing partition and the pool recycles aggressively. A fix is scheduled; until then, please validate your plugin against our sandbox replica, reachable via the connection string below.

primary connection of yagep-kahip = redis://giliel_svc:zYiKsLL2PLpfPL@db-348f.xolmarsys.corp:5432/fenwyn

## Deploy Step 4 — Flowgate Autoscaler

Ship order: scaler first, workers second. Pull the `flowgate-v1.9` image, confirm `QUEUE_POLL_INTERVAL=5s` and `SCALE_CEILING=40` in the env file. Do not reuse staging values; Brindle cluster saturates at 24. Restart the poller after any env change or depth readings go stale. Metrics land in the `flowgate.depth` series — verify before handing off. The scaler also needs its broker auth secret in the same env file, which goes on the following line:

sealed setting: ARCHIVE_KEY3=8d0